Synthesis and Crystal Structure of a Novel Supra‐Molecular Compound [Co(tsc)2][NPA]2 · 4H2O (tsc=Thiosemicarbazide, H2NPA=3‐Nitro‐Phthalic Acid)

2006 
The supramolecular compound [Co(tsc)2][NPA]2 · 4H2O has been synthesized, with its crystal structure characterized by IR spectrum and X‐ray crystallography diffraction. It belongs to triclinic crystal with p‐1 space group. Unit cell dimensions are a=6.6585(13) A, b=6.6585(13) A, c=13.871(3) A; α=86.64(3)°, β=89.78(3)°, γ=75.42(3)°, V=717.9(2) A3. Characterization reveals that 3‐nitro‐hphthalate anions as hydrogen bond acceptor bonds to two different cations in parallel and vertical directions, respectively. All of the potential hydrogen bond donors and acceptors are involved in hydrogen bonds, leading to a 2D supramolecular layer structure.
